Contact numbers667 266 591
91 042 48 03
Opening times: Monday to FridayFrom 9.00 to 14.00 and from 16.00 to 19.00
Contact numbers667 266 591
91 042 48 03
Opening times: Monday to FridayFrom 9.00 to 14.00 and from 16.00 to 19.00

jquery find index of child in parent

jquery find index of child in parent

second)? rev2023.7.27.43548. . What is Mathematica's equivalent to Maple's collect with distributed option? Can Henzie blitz cards exiled with Atsushi? How to display Latin Modern Math font correctly in Mathematica? Web hosting by Digital Ocean | CDN by StackPath. Fastest way to find the index of a child node in parent Would fixed-wing aircraft still exist if helicopters had been invented (and flown) before them? Use the children() or find() methods to traverse a single level down the DOM tree or all the way down to the last descendant. Here we discuss the definition, syntax, What is jQuery parent find, how to work, and Examples with code.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ing, Just wanted to make it clear that singular "parent()". What is involved with it? This is from. Why do code answers tend to be given in Python when no language is specified in the prompt? Enjoy our free tutorials like millions of other internet users since 1999, Explore our selection of references covering all popular coding languages, Create your own website with W3Schools Spaces - no setup required, Test your skills with different exercises, Test yourself with multiple choice questions, Create a free W3Schools Account to Improve Your Learning Experience, Track your learning progress at W3Schools and collect rewards, Become a PRO user and unlock powerful features (ad-free, hosting, videos,..), Not sure where you want to start? A string containing a selector expression to match elements against.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Both the parent () and parents () methods traverse up the DOM tree and return the parent element. This method allows us to search through the children of these elements in the DOM tree and construct a new jQuery object from the matching elements. The best way would probably be using closest: Closest works by first looking at the current element to see if it matches the specified expression, if so it just returns the element itself. Not the answer you're looking for? By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. For benchmarking what the result of the test would be if the browser optimized out the searching. Praents: Returned jQuery object contains zero or more elements for each element in the original set, in reverse document order. Is it possible to get element's numerical index in its parent node without looping? Would you publish a deeply personal essay about mental illness during PhD? In jQuery, the parent () method retrieves all ancestor items of the specified selector. 1.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. OverflowAI: Where Community & AI Come Together, Get index of element as child relative to parent, Behind the scenes with the folks building OverflowAI (Ep. This solution works like a charm, just want to point a caveat: interesting alternative, although potentially a lot slower, New! This function explores the DOM tree upwards from the parent element, returning all ancestors of the specified element. Is the DC-6 Supercharged? jQuery parent() Method - W3Schools By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. For 65536, only 256! Modified 2 years, 11 months ago. Not the answer you're looking for? Visit Wikipedia. +1. How can I identify and sort groups of text lines separated by a blank line? Manga where the MC is kicked out of party and uses electric magic on his head to forget things, Continuous Variant of the Chinese Remainder Theorem. How to get the index of an element containing specific child. Is this merely the process of the node syncing with the network? jQuery children () method returns all direct children of each element in the set of matched elements. What mathematical topics are important for succeeding in an undergrad PDE course? jQuery: how to get which button was clicked upon form submission? *Note that the id will change to different divs node, so it will need to be able to re-calculate. The .parents(selector) says get all ancestors that match the selector, and the :eq(1) says find the oneth (zero-indexed, so the second) element in the list. Can a judge or prosecutor be compelled to testify in a criminal trial in which they officiated? The jQuery index () function searches for the specified element among the matched elements, if the element is found it, then it returns the index of the element, if the element is not found in the matched elements, then it returns -1. Return This .index method is super helpful to me. send a video file once and multiple users stream it?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Inspired by user1689607's answer, recent browsers have another property besides .previousSibling called .previousElementSibling, which does both original statements in one. Thanks for the inspiration; I've added a version of this to my answer that puts the condition outside using feature detection of. However rather than attaching one click handler for each list item it is better (performance wise) to use delegate which would look like this: In jQuery 1.7+, you should use on. If it wasn't for IE8, this would be a pretty decent solution; I've added this improvement in my jsperf test as well.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Connect and share knowledge within a single location that is structured and easy to search. Find centralized, trusted content and collaborate around the technologies you use most. is there a limit of speed cops can go on a high speed pursuit? Is it normal for relative humidity to increase when the attic fan turns on? Are arguments that Reason is circular themselves circular and/or self refuting. Description: Selects all direct child elements specified by "child" of elements specified by "parent". If no matching element is found then none will be returned. Manga where the MC is kicked out of party and uses electric magic on his head to forget things, How to draw a specific color with gpu shader. Its a built-in jQuery function. Why is an arrow pointing through a glass of water only flipped vertically but not horizontally? Can a judge or prosecutor be compelled to testify in a criminal trial in which they officiated? index should do the trick. "Sibi quisque nunc nominet eos quibus scit et vinum male credi et sermonem bene". Return the direct parent of each element rev2023.7.27.43548. Are self-signed SSL certificates still allowed in 2023 for an intranet server running IIS? 594), Stack Overflow at WeAreDevelopers World Congress in Berlin, Temporary policy: Generative AI (e.g., ChatGPT) is banned, Preview of Search and Question-Asking Powered by GenAI, Alternatives to many parent() in selection. Is it superfluous to place a snubber in parallel with a diode by default? Description: Get the ancestors of each element in the current set of matched elements, optionally filtered by a selector. @steweb - It is also lighter because jquery doesnt need to do an initial lookup of all the li elements. ok, so, managing events in this way it's something lighter than the classic 'dom attachment' :) ..thanks! It's a built-in jQuery function. Young Chinese are getting paid to be 'full-time children' as jobs Why do code answers tend to be given in Python when no language is specified in the prompt? Help the lynx collect pine cones, Join our newsletter and get access to exclusive content every month. How and why does electrometer measures the potential differences? How can I identify and sort groups of text lines separated by a blank line? What is the latent heat of melting for a everyday soda lime glass. It should work.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ing. With jQuery you can traverse up the DOM tree to find ancestors of an element. ALL RIGHTS RESERVED. When a parent is applied to a set of items, it returns a list of their immediate parents. Both of them perform extremely well in modern browsers (which is most browsers in use today), but will take a small hit in older browsers. Here is a solution I created using tables. Thanks for contributing an answer to Stack Overflow! My first attempt was using .parentNode.childNodes but that gives incorrect results due to text nodes.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ing, New! In exchange, they pay her 8,000 yuan ($1,115) a month, which is about the average salary in China. In jQuery, the parent() method is used to locate the parent element of the currently selected element. This will give you the first (:eq(0)) parent that matches being the tag you're searching for. For What Kinds Of Problems is Quantile Regression Useful? Using jQuery's .index () Function .index () is a method on jQuery objects that's generally used to search for a given element within the jQuery object that it's called on. For a list of trademarks of the OpenJS Foundation, please see our Trademark Policy and Trademark List. W3Schools offers a wide range of services and products for beginners and professionals, helping millions of people everyday to learn and master new skills. Find centralized, trusted content and collaborate around the technologies you use most. :nth-child() Selector | jQuery API Documentation I am currently trying to find the parent of a parent of an element. that obviously doesn't work, but how do I grab the li element? You can also try $(this).parents(tag) , where tag is the tag you want to find. In a jQuery parent find syntax, the filter is an optional parameter used to specify the selector expression for parent search. Optionally, the jQuery parent find method accepts a selection expression of the same type as the $() function. rev2023.7.27.43548. from former US Fed. Attaching events to the dom can be expensive if you have large lists so as a rule I try to use the above where possible rather than individual handlers on each element. Asking for help, clarification, or responding to other answers. 594), Stack Overflow at WeAreDevelopers World Congress in Berlin, Temporary policy: Generative AI (e.g., ChatGPT) is banned, Preview of Search and Question-Asking Powered by GenAI, How to get the element number/index between siblings, Get current position of an element within the DOM, JQuery - Determining parent index from its children. How to get the index of an element containing specific child. return the parent

  • element with class name "first" of each . How to get the ID of a row when clicking the button in the same row? Both the parent() and parents() methods traverse up the DOM tree and return the parent element. I went ahead and added it to the test linked at the top of this answer. In this test, we will see how long it takes for a linear search to find the middle element VS a binary search.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Effect of temperature on Forcefield parameters in classical molecular dynamics simulations, Unpacking "If they have a question for the lawyers, they've got to go outside and the grand jurors can ask questions." Can you have ChatGPT 4 "explain" how it generated an answer? JQuery, find parent - Stack Overflow How to help my stubborn colleague learn new ways of coding? Connect and share knowledge within a single location that is structured and easy to search. @user1689607, I wasn't aware that jQuery data was THAT slow. Then, the way that you use it is by getting the 'parentIndex' property of any element. Why wont "$(this).parent().parent()" work? All you're doing is wasting time by creating another jQuery object New! To get the index of the clicked element, get the closest ancestor .col and call index on it. Select Parent Row when any Child Grid Row is Selected - Kendo - Telerik Since you are using jQuery. For What Kinds Of Problems is Quantile Regression Useful? The Problem This isn't quite as fast as the previousElementSibling versions, but is still faster than the others (at least in Firefox). You can do parent of a parent and it's very easy: Thanks for contributing an answer to Stack Overflow! Since the 10 commandments are Old Testament Law, are we to only follow the New Testament commands? Plumbing inspection passed but pressure drops to zero overnight. This function explores the DOM tree upwards from the parent element, returning all ancestors of the specified element. rev2023.7.27.43548. When I click on the element, i'd like to get it's parent
  • 's index number. You might try alerting this, to make sure it is an html anchor tag. Changing the child element's CSS when the parent is hovered, Avoid dropdown menu close on click inside, jQuery click event on parent, but finding the child (clicked) element, Set width of a "Position: fixed" div relative to parent div, Fire click event on a div excluding one child div and it's descendents. The below example shows the jQuery parent find a method to return all ancestor elements are as follows. Return the direct parent element of : The parent() method returns the direct parent element of the selected Out of curiosity I ran your code against both jQuery's .index() and my below code: It turns out that jQuery is roughly 50% slower than your implementation (on Chrome/Mac) and mine arguably topped it by 1%. How can I upload files asynchronously with jQuery? Find centralized, trusted content and collaborate around the technologies you use most. the DOM tree. 2. Only one level of the HTML DOM tree is traversed with the parent() method. Little weird indeed. Eliminative materialism eliminates itself - a familiar idea? Can I board a train without a valid ticket if I have a Rail Travel Voucher. How to find the shortest path visiting all nodes in a connected graph as MILP? Your optimization failed to meet the requirement: Well, it actually did a little better than I expected in Firefox, but overall it's not terribly fast and slower than some other solutions. How to get index of element by parent in JQuery - Stack Overflow See more numbers/statistics. If you're getting that error, you're using different code - it sounds like you're using jQuery, but my answer is showing how to accomplish this sort of thing, Fair enough. How does jQuery parent find works with Examples? - EDUCBA Couldn't quite let this one go, so I've added two more approaches: Improvement on my earlier experimental code, as seen in HBP's answer, the DOMNodeList is treated like an array and it uses Array.indexOf() to determine the position within its .parentNode.children which are all elements. JS/jQuery - Get parent of iframe from child (child > iframe > parent). By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. I would prefer to use native js. Connect and share knowledge within a single location that is structured and easy to search. Effect of temperature on Forcefield parameters in classical molecular dynamics simulations. Since the 10 commandments are Old Testament Law, are we to only follow the New Testament commands? To learn more, see our tips on writing great answers.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ing. How do I check whether a checkbox is checked in jQuery? edit: I've removed the jQuery I used. [jQuery] How to find the index of the parent of a specific element

    West Plains School Calendar 2023-2024, Echecopar G Wake Tech Rate My Professor, Speedplay Zero Aero Pedals, Articles J

  • jquery find index of child in parent

    jquery find index of child in parent